Macbook M1 에서 터미널 세팅 (brew, zsh, iterm, oh-my-zsh)
·
DEV/잡다한 개발 일지
드디어 제가 macbook pro M1 을 구매했습니다 😍 오늘 따끈하게 배송 왔는데 오자마자 한 일은 터미널 세팅 -_- 기존에 리눅스에서도 oh-my-zsh로 편하게 터미널을 사용했어서 맥북도 바로 적용했습니다. 🖖 iTerm2 설치 https://iterm2.com iTerm2 - macOS Terminal Replacement iTerm2 by George Nachman. Website by Matthew Freeman, George Nachman, and James A. Rosen. Website updated and optimized by HexBrain iterm2.com 링크를 타고 들어가서 다운로드 해줍시다. iterm2는 m1을 지원하니 바로 받아서 사용하면 됩니다. 설치 후 Dock에..
[Node.js] Express, TypeScript, MongoDB 회원가입 (1)
·
DEV/Node.js
💻 코드 https://github.com/jokj624/authCRUD-TS jokj624/authCRUD-TS Node js, Express, MongoDB, TypeScript 회원가입, 로그인 CRUD 구현 연습 - jokj624/authCRUD-TS github.com 🤔 why? 곧 .. 다가올 앱잼을 압두고 서버 말하는 감자인 내가 조금이라도 공부를 해야겠다 하고 로그인/회원가입을 3 Layer Architecture 로 설계해보자 하고 공부를 시작했다. 원래는 api 내에 라우트, 컨트롤러, 서비스 로직을 다 넣어놓는 식으로 구현했는데 제대로 설계해보고 싶다. 많은 블로그와 SOPT 세미나에서 한 내용, github들을 참고해서 해보았다. 아직 코드를 조금 더 리팩토링 해야하지만 간단한 구..
[BOJ/21924] 도시 건설, c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/21924 21924번: 도시 건설 첫 번째 줄에 건물의 개수 $N$ $(3 \le N \le 10^5 )$와 도로의 개수 $M$ $(2 \le M \le min( {N(N-1) \over 2}, 5×10^5)) $가 주어진다. 두 번째 줄 부터 $M + 1$줄까지 건물의 번호 $a$, $b$ $(1 \le a, b \le N, a ≠ b)$와 두 www.acmicpc.net 🤯 한줄 후기 한줄 후기 : 이름 부터 mst 마음이 편해진다. 🤷 문제 👩‍💻 풀이 최소 스패닝 트리(MST) 문제이다. 추가된 문제에 떠있길래 이름이 뭔가 MST 같아서 들어가봤더니 역시 MST 였다. 건물을 모두 연결하는 도로를 선택해야 하므로 바로 MST 라는..
[BOJ/2023] 신기한 소수, c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/2023 2023번: 신기한 소수 수빈이가 세상에서 가장 좋아하는 것은 소수이고, 취미는 소수를 가지고 노는 것이다. 요즘 수빈이가 가장 관심있어 하는 소수는 7331이다. 7331은 소수인데, 신기하게도 733도 소수이고, 73도 소수 www.acmicpc.net https://github.com/jokj624/PS/blob/master/1000-5000/2023.cpp jokj624/PS BOJ, CodeForces 알고리즘 문제 소스코드. Contribute to jokj624/PS development by creating an account on GitHub. github.com 🤯 한줄 후기 한줄 후기 : 그래프 분류 안봤으면 ..
[BOJ/21921] 블로그 , c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/21921 21921번: 블로그 첫째 줄에 $X$일 동안 가장 많이 들어온 방문자 수를 출력한다. 만약 최대 방문자 수가 0명이라면 SAD를 출력한다. 만약 최대 방문자 수가 0명이 아닌 경우 둘째 줄에 기간이 몇 개 있는지 출력한다 www.acmicpc.net https://github.com/jokj624/PS/blob/master/20000-25000/21921.cpp jokj624/PS BOJ, CodeForces 알고리즘 문제 소스코드. Contribute to jokj624/PS development by creating an account on GitHub. github.com 🤯 한줄 후기 한줄 후기 : 제목에 이끌림 🤷 문..
[BOJ/9202] Boggle, c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/9202 9202번: Boggle 각각의 Boggle에 대해, 얻을 수 있는 최대 점수, 가장 긴 단어, 찾은 단어의 개수를 출력한다. 한 Boggle에서 같은 단어를 여러 번 찾은 경우에는 한 번만 찾은 것으로 센다. 가장 긴 단어가 여러 개 www.acmicpc.net https://github.com/jokj624/PS/blob/master/5000-10000/9202.cpp jokj624/PS BOJ, CodeForces 알고리즘 문제 소스코드. Contribute to jokj624/PS development by creating an account on GitHub. github.com 🤯 한줄 후기 한줄 후기 : 와 역대급 힘..
[BOJ/21872] Deque Game, c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/21872 21872번: Deque Game 게임 1 연돌이는 $19$가지 방식으로 $3$층 스택을 만들 수 있고, 세순이는 $1$가지 방식으로 $3$층 스택을 만들 수 있다. 따라서 연돌이가 Deque Game에서 승리한다. 연돌이 : $000, 001, 002, 010, 011, 012, 020 www.acmicpc.net https://github.com/jokj624/PS/blob/master/20000-25000/21872.cpp jokj624/PS BOJ, CodeForces 알고리즘 문제 소스코드. Contribute to jokj624/PS development by creating an account on GitHub. g..
[BOJ/1103] 게임, c++
·
DEV/PS
🔗 링크 https://www.acmicpc.net/problem/1103 1103번: 게임 줄에 보드의 세로 크기 N과 가로 크기 M이 주어진다. 이 값은 모두 50보다 작거나 같은 자연수이다. 둘째 줄부터 N개의 줄에 보드의 상태가 주어진다. 쓰여 있는 숫자는 1부터 9까지의 자연수 또는 www.acmicpc.net https://github.com/jokj624/PS/blob/master/1000-5000/1103.cpp jokj624/PS BOJ, CodeForces 알고리즘 문제 소스코드. Contribute to jokj624/PS development by creating an account on GitHub. github.com 🤯 한줄 후기 코드 순서 조심하자 😭 🤷 문제 👩‍💻 풀이 굉..
Node.js , express, mongoDB, typescript 초기 설정
·
DEV/Node.js
https://github.com/jokj624/node-typescript-init jokj624/node-typescript-init nodejs express mongoDB typescript 초기 개발 환경 구축 . Contribute to jokj624/node-typescript-init development by creating an account on GitHub. github.com 나는 초기 설정 맨날 까먹어서 . . . 솝커톤 때 허둥지둥 할까봐 세미나때 배운 내용 그대로 미리 레포로 파뒀다. .env 파일만 만들어 놓고, 실행시키면 로컬 서버 실행과 몽고디비 연결이 되게끔 설정 했다. tfconfig.json { "compilerOptions": { "target": "es6", "..